Ross Girvan, DPM, FACFAS
Dr. Ross Girvan spent years competing as an internationally ranked pole vaulter. That experience and his interest in wellness, sports nutrition and enjoyment working with people of all ages and backgrounds led to his career as a podiatrist.
Board Certified in reconstructive foot and ankle surgery, he's skilled at diagnosing and treating any foot or ankle condition due to injury, biomechanics, disease or genetics. Local athletes find his background in sports to be especially helpful in treating common injuries.
Dr. Girvan enjoys treating patients from infants to senior citizens. Patients appreciate his personable, friendly manner and his excellent clinical treatment and surgical results.
